How to Fix Error 158

Topic: Spotify Playback Errors | Status: Updated

What is this error?

Error 158 in Spotify typically indicates a problem with your network connection or an issue related to the Spotify app's configuration. This error can prevent users from streaming music or accessing their playlists effectively.

How to Fix It

  1. Check Network Connection: Ensure that you are connected to a stable Wi-Fi or mobile network. Try opening a website in your browser to confirm internet access.
  2. Restart the Spotify App: Close the Spotify application completely and then restart it. This can help reset any temporary glitches causing the error.
  3. Clear Cache: Go to your device settings, find Spotify in your application manager, and clear its cache. This can clear any corrupted files that may be causing playback issues.
  4. Update the App: Check for updates in the app store and install the latest version of Spotify. Running an outdated version can lead to various playback errors.
  5. Reinstall Spotify: If the error persists, uninstall the app and then reinstall it. This can resolve many underlying issues related to corrupted installation files.
  6. Check Firewall and Security Settings: Ensure that your firewall or any security software is not blocking Spotify. Allow Spotify through the firewall settings if necessary.
  7. Contact Support: If none of the above steps resolve the issue, consider reaching out to Spotify support for further assistance. Provide them with detailed information about the error.
